Step 6. So to create the texture and the spikes I work wet in wet with a mixture of cobalt blue and cadmium red. The whole hedgehog is very wet and I drop colours into it where I think they work best. Step 7 Finishing touches. I like to flick some white acrylic to add more texture on the spikes, as well as some darker purple.

Black Details: Using your black paint and a small brush, carefully paint the hedgehog's: * Nose: A small black triangle. * Eyes: Two small black dots. * Spines: Add small, slightly curved lines all over the hedgehog's back, creating the appearance of spines. Be sure to leave gaps between the spines so the blue shows.
